The physical appearance of these felines complements their amazing personality. Most say that Aby looks like she just came home from the wild. The reason behind this conception is the ticked fur coat of the cats, resembling the pattern worn by wild cats like the cougars. Know that a ticked coat shows the bands of alternating light and dark colors.
These colors support the glowing and warm appearance of the breed, but its texture is fine, soft, and silky to the touch.
In general, an Aby coat comes in varied colors, including the following:
